Anonymous wrote:I just had my uterus, cervix and Fallopian tubes removed, pelvic floor lift and urethra mesh placement. It was done vaginally and laparoscopically by Dr. Welgoss at Inova Fairfax. He was absolutely amazing. I had 5 fibroids that sat on my bladder and caused a rectocele.
I feel like a new person in terms of no longer having to pee all the time.
There is a problem you need to be aware of. I developed a small pulmonary embolism. It can happen after this type of surgery. I followed the directions of taking it easy. Make sure you walk to keep your blood circulating. I am grateful to God that my embolism was small and did not kill me.
The only symptom I had of the embolism was that I developed a fever. Dr. Welgoss and his staff were so in tune with my care that they sent me back to the hospital right away when I told them I have a fever. Make sure you have a surgeon that is as awesome as he is.
Bottom line...have an amazing surgeon and walk as much as you can to keep from getting a blood clot.
